Hybrid training (voluntary and electrical muscle contractions) can ameliorate insulin resistance by suppressing serum IL-6 levels in skeletal muscle.

Combining voluntary exercise with electrical muscle stimulation may help reduce inflammation and improve insulin sensitivity, particularly for those with fatty liver disease.

ModerateSupportsMEDIUM confidence
Therefore, hybrid training can ameliorate insulin resistance by suppressing serum IL-6 in skeletal muscle [34].
Li Chen et al. · International Journal of Endocrinology · 2015

Why this rating

Based on a single pilot study cited (Ref 34), so evidence is preliminary.
